Tax Debt in Bankruptcy
As a general rule tax debt — particularly IRS tax debt — is not dischargeable in bankruptcy. While this is true in many cases, certain types of tax debt may be discharged in bankruptcy. However, such discharge requires that very specific criteria are met.
There are many complex rules and timing factors that impact the ability to Discharge of tax debt requires navigation through very complex rules and is time sensitive. In some cases, for example, if a tax debt is more than three years old and you have not made a payment during that time, it may be possible to have the debt discharged.
